Physiological fallout
Here is the deal: a horse’s cooling system is a delicate balance of respiration, sweating, and circulatory shunting. When the mercury climbs above 30°C, sweating spikes, electrolytes drain, and blood diverted to the skin steals oxygen from the muscles. The result? Tiredness that looks like laziness, but is pure metabolic fatigue. One‑minute interval tests show lactate rising 30 percent faster under heat stress. Trainers who ignore that data are essentially betting against physics.

Track tactics under the sun
The race itself rewrites strategy. Jockeys pull the reins earlier, opting for a slower early pace to conserve the animal’s heat budget. The once‑favoured “hold the lead” tactic becomes a liability; a front‑runner can overheat in the first half, fade, and hand the win to a late‑closing outsider who stayed cool. Those outsiders—usually the ones with a lighter frame and efficient thermoregulation—shine when the sun blazes.
Don’t be fooled by pedigree alone. A thoroughbred bred for speed on a cool day may crumble at 32°C, while a sturdy jumper with a modest sprint record could out‑run the favorite simply because its cardiovascular system tolerates heat better. Training adaptations
Smart trainers prep their charges with heat acclimation protocols. They’ll run morning sessions on a heated sand‑track, let the horses sweat out the toxins, and then cool them with ice‑water hosing. The goal is to boost plasma volume by 10‑15%, a buffer that delays the onset of heat‑induced fatigue. Hydration gels enriched with electrolytes are now a staple, not a novelty. If you ever see a horse’s tongue sticking out in a bright crimson, that’s a red flag—stop the horse, rehydrate, and reassess.
What about nutrition? High‑fat diets supply slow‑burn calories that generate less heat per unit of work, whereas high‑carb feeds can raise metabolic heat. A diet tweak from 60% carbs to 30% fat can shave seconds off a race time under torrid conditions.
